I've bought 4 of them used for..
$400 w/ UV case AND Evo bridge pickup.. very good condition..royal blue $200 bone stock and lil beat up.. royal blue $200 stock and finish completely stripped to wood.. was gunmetal grey $375 stock, but absolutely beautiful.. black so, my guess is that this guy is shooting for a buyer that is desperate for a 7620. Is it worth what he's asking.. if it truly is in nearly unplayed condition, it probably is considering that alot of 7 stringers prefer the 7620 to most other similar Ibanez 7's. However, being patient will pay off as I see these all the time, in great condition and upgraded pickups, for $600 or less. He talks about the stock pickups in 7620 are better than _____. The stock pickups on 7620 are no better than most other stock Ibanez.. and will most likely find themselves in the parts bin after you decide they suck ass compared to almost any other budget high output pickup.
